The Lesotho Correctional Services (LCS) has reported that there are just over 2,600 inmates across its facilities nationwide. Of these, 541 inmates are HIV positive and currently on antiretroviral (ARV) medication. For more information, click the link 👇 uncensored.org.za/1-in-5-inmates…

No one should have a hole between the birth canal and the bladder or between the bladder and the rectum. When such a hole forms, a woman loses control over urinating or passing stool—it just leaks without her realising or feeling the urge. This is called obstetric fistula.
